

























We introduce a new family of symmetric multivariate polynomials, whose coefficients are meromorphic functions of two parameters $(q,t)$ and polynomial in a further two parameters $(u,v)$. We evaluate these polynomials explicitly as a matrix product. At $u=v=0$ they reduce to Macdonald polynomials, while at $q=0$, $u=v=s$ they recover a family of inhomogeneous symmetric functions originally introduced by Borodin.
